3.3V differential transceiver for RS-485 half-duplex communication. Features a 1Mbps data rate and operates from a 3V to 3.6V supply. This through-hole mounted component is housed in an 8-pin PDIP package, with a 0°C to 70°C operating temperature range. Includes one driver and one receiver for transceiver functionality.
